I guess you're refering to this tutorial?

In fact there weren't any big changes when it comes to handling the FMB .. and KiwiBiggles' tut's are a great starting point for getting used to it ;)

Of course there are a few objects (especially the C&C ones) where you'll have to know what you're doing, but those have their own manuals in the release files.

For the beginning I'd recommend you to get used to FMB itself (read: build a few small & easy missions yourself). Have a look how certain changes in the FMB mean influence the mission and its outcome.
If you don't know about the basics, building/editing larger missions can get frustrating very fast ..
